LiveStreams is a YouTube show dedicated to exploring Confluent and real-time data streaming technologies, offering practical insights into coding and DevOps. Each episode provides hands-on experience with tools such as Kafka and Confluent, addressing common questions from a global audience. The show covers a range of topics, including setting up Spring Boot with Confluent Cloud, processing data with Kafka Streams, and optimizing data using binary formats like Avro and Protobuf. It also delves into automating tasks with ccloud-stack, building event-driven microservices, and utilizing ksqlDB Java client for data interaction. Episodes further explore integrating Project Reactor with ksqlDB for reactive programming, generating materialized views for data access, and combining Kubernetes, Spring Boot, and Kafka Streams for advanced application deployment. The program emphasizes a transition in Spring Cloud Stream towards a function-based approach, simplifying the creation of event-driven applications.
